💡
原文中文,约32800字,阅读约需78分钟。
📝
内容提要
本文介绍了数字证书和TLS协议的基本概念及应用。数字证书通过公钥基础设施(PKI)确保公钥的真实性,从而实现安全通信。TLS协议结合对称与非对称加密,提供安全的数据传输。文章还讨论了证书类型、申请流程及其在HTTPS中的重要性,强调了证书管理和更新的必要性,以防止安全漏洞。
🎯
关键要点
- 数字证书通过公钥基础设施(PKI)确保公钥的真实性,解决公钥分发中的安全问题。
- TLS协议结合对称与非对称加密,提供安全的数据传输,支持完美前向保密特性。
- 证书类型包括公网受信任证书、本地签名证书和自签名证书,分别适用于不同的场景。
- 证书申请流程可以通过ACME协议实现自动化,支持免费和付费服务。
- 证书的有效期应控制在合理范围内,以防止安全漏洞,建议设置自动轮转机制。
- TLS协议的历史版本包括TLS 1.1、TLS 1.2和TLS 1.3,后者提供更高的安全性和性能。
- 证书锁定和公钥锁定技术用于防止中间人攻击,确保通信的安全性。
- OCSP协议用于证书状态查询,支持证书的吊销管理,提升安全性。
❓
延伸问答
数字证书的主要功能是什么?
数字证书通过公钥基础设施(PKI)确保公钥的真实性,从而实现安全通信。
TLS协议是如何确保数据传输安全的?
TLS协议结合对称与非对称加密,提供安全的数据传输,并支持完美前向保密特性。
证书的申请流程是怎样的?
证书申请流程可以通过ACME协议实现自动化,支持免费和付费服务。
数字证书的有效期应该如何设置?
证书的有效期应控制在合理范围内,建议设置自动轮转机制,以防止安全漏洞。
TLS协议的历史版本有哪些?
TLS协议的历史版本包括TLS 1.1、TLS 1.2和TLS 1.3,后者提供更高的安全性和性能。
OCSP协议在证书管理中有什么作用?
OCSP协议用于证书状态查询,支持证书的吊销管理,提升安全性。
➡️